Authorship and Creation
The Virgin of Stamboul's producer is recorded as Carl Laemmle[19]. Its director is recorded as Tod Browning[6]. Screenwriters include Tod Browning[7] and William Parker[8]. Cast members include Priscilla Dean[12], Wheeler Vivian Oakman[13], Wallace Beery[14], Nigel De Brulier[15], Edmund Burns[16], and Eugenie Forde[17].
Publication
The Virgin of Stamboul's publication date is recorded as +1920-03-27T00:00:00Z[26]. Genres include silent film[9], drama film[10], and adventure film[11].
